Smoking harms the voice box, causing hoarseness and a raspy tone. Dr Neetu Jain of PSRI Hospital, Delhi explains that cigarette smoke irritates the larynx. Even one cigarette can cause temporary swelling. Regular smoking may lead to chronic inflammation or cancer. E-cigarettes also cause dryness and hoarseness. Early damage is often reversible if smoking stops. Warning signs include frequent throat clearing and reduced vocal stamina. Quitting smoking early helps prevent permanent voice damage.
